Transaction 439eae36e6ad3bc5c1f20dc81f07f817ff8a8ba146995668b587a55a043dff8d

5 Input
1 Outputs
  • 439eae36e6ad3bc5c1f20dc81f07f817ff8a8ba146995668b587a55a043dff8d:0
  • value  752259
    address  35Ph8hMUr4GBYEePzEVLNNNYmFCCY42fAd